  • title - Toyota Mirai
  • htmlTextData.content.items[0].content - <p>The all-new Toyota Mirai is the beginning of a hydrogen-powered zero-emissions mobility era. Powered by a fuel-cell electric power train, the Mirai is quiet, and smooth, with a strong performance and no tailpipe emissions, which reduces CO₂ emissions and the environmental impact on our planet. The Mirai on Mzansi soil is a glimpse into what Carbon Neutrality by 2050 looks like. </p> <p>*Not commercially sold</p>

  • textWithImageData.title - Hydrogen Fuel Cell
  • textWithImageData.theme - default
  • textWithImageData.subTitle - How It Works
  • textWithImageData.description - <p>The Toyota Mirai generates power by combining hydrogen with oxygen from the outside air. On the road, hydrogen from the fuel tank and air entering from the intake grille meet in the Fuel Cell Stack. There, a chemical reaction involving oxygen in the air, and hydrogen, creates electricity — powering the Mirai. In the end, the only by-product is water and heat. This ensures that there are no harmful emissions.</p>

    • generalData[0].title - Filling up the Mirai
    • generalData[0].content - <p>There’s a pump and a nozzle, much like you would find at a filling station. As you pump in the hydrogen, it travels to carbon-fibre reinforced fuel tanks where it is stored. After a few minutes, you’ll be ready to hit the road while enjoying all the safety, technology, and comfort you expect from a Toyota. In addition, the Mirai features three high-pressure carbon-fibre-enforced-polymer hydrogen tanks for extended range.</p>

    • generalData[1].title - Hydrogen Power – the future of electricity
    • generalData[1].content - <p>A fuel cell uses the chemical energy of hydrogen and oxygen to produce electricity without harmful emissions. The Toyota Mirai has a large front grille that takes in oxygen from the atmosphere. The hydrogen is stored in the Mirai’s durable and purpose-built tanks before being released into the fuel cell system. In the fuel cell system, hydrogen and oxygen from the air combine in a chemical reaction that creates electricity to power the electric motor. After the chemical reaction creates electricity, the only emission is water vapour, which helps keep the environment clean.</p>

    • generalData[2].title - Clean & Efficient
    • generalData[2].content - <p>The Toyota Mirai is an extremely efficient hydrogen vehicle. Thanks to its borrowed hybrid regenerative technology, electricity can be harnessed and saved when braking. Also, Hydrogen-powered fuel cell electric vehicles don't need a large bank of heavy batteries, making them lighter and more agile. And, unlike battery-powered electric vehicles, refuelling is quick and easy. So, no long waiting periods to get back on the road.</p>

    • generalData[3].title - Hydrogen fuel cell safety
    • generalData[3].content - <p>The Toyota Mirai chassis is designed around the fuel cell system to protect components in a collision and is equipped with safety sensors to detect potential hydrogen leaks. In addition, if a collision is detected, the hydrogen tank valves are shut off.<br /> <br /> The Mirai’s hydrogen high-pressure tanks have a three-layer safety structure consisting of:</p> <ul> <li>Surface layer – fibreglass-reinforced polymer</li> <li>Middle layer – carbon fibre reinforced plastic</li> <li>Interior layer – plastic liner</li> </ul> <p> </p> <p>*Local specifications may differ.</p>
